英文摘要 | Improved reconstructions of Australia's climate during Marine Isotope Stage 3 (MIS 3) are important for understanding the environmental context of widespread human settlement of the continent and the extinction of a wide range of megafauna by 45 ± 5 thousand years ago (ka). To better understand spatial and temporal climate trends during this period, we present a synthesis of hydroclimate data from 40 Australian MIS 3 records. Hydroclimate records were evaluated and weighted by a scoring system developed to evaluate dating and proxy quality and resolution before inclusion into the synthesis. Our analysis reveals that Australia experienced spatially variable climates from ∼57 to 49 ka before becoming predominantly wet from ∼49 to 40 ka. After ∼40 ka increasingly dry climates dominated MIS 3. Records from monsoon-influenced regions indicate a rapid drying from ∼48 ka to the end of MIS 3, while there was a wetter period from ∼50 to 40 ka in south westerly wind-influenced records. The implications of our findings are discussed in relation to other proxy records, with there being a significant relationship with regional fire history, but little correlation to atmospheric CO2 concentration or global sea level. © 2018 Elsevier Ltd |
